## Divestiture of the Calyx Instruments Unit (Managers Only)

Hollenbeck Group has entered exclusive negotiations to sell its Calyx Instruments unit to Tarnwell Holdings. The transaction covers manufacturing assets in Dунmore Vale, associated inventory, and roughly 140 staff transfers. Finance should treat the unit as held-for-sale from this quarter, with impairment testing completed before close. Working capital adjustments remain under discussion. The confidential summary of next steps appears directly below.

management briefing: Project Ulavan slips by two quarters because of the staffing delay.

### Runbook: BounceBroom — Account Recovery

If the BounceBroom email bounce processor loses access to its service account, do not create a new one. First, pause the intake queue so bounces buffer safely. Then open the recovery console and select the BounceBroom principal. Verification requires approval from the on-call lead. Once approved, the console prompts for the stored recovery credentials; enter the passphrase that appears directly below this paragraph.

recovery phrase for fahof-kahap: holion-gormir-jorix-istix-briwyn-sorael

## Account Recovery — Trailnote Offline Mode

When a surveyor's Trailnote app has been offline for 30+ days, their local credentials expire and sync refuses to resume. Don't make them wipe the device — all their unsynced field data lives there! Instead, open the support console, pick "Offline Reinstate," and enter their handle. The console will ask for the support team's shared recovery passphrase before issuing a reinstatement token. Use the one below.

unlock words, bagaf-fajeg: zorael-kelax-fraath-quenix-eliok-sileth-aldmir-wenir-druiel